Shopify Rebellion Makes History: First North American Team to Qualify for Siege X Esports World Cup.

Shopify Rebellion's Unmatched Group Stage Performance
The North America League 2025 has been a proving ground for Shopify Rebellion, who completed their group stage with an exceptional record. With eight victories in regulation play and just one overtime loss, they amassed a total of 26 points, marking the most successful stage in the league's history. The Epic Clash Against M80
The semifinal match against M80 was a rollercoaster of emotions, showcasing the competitive spirit that defines esports. M80, a formidable opponent, managed to break Shopify Rebellion's unbeaten map streak early in the series with a convincing 7-4 win on Chalet. This moment marked a significant achievement for M80, as they became the first team to claim a map victory against the Rebellion this season.
However, Shopify Rebellion showcased their resilience in the second map, Nighthaven Labs, where they pushed the series to a dramatic third map after clinching a hard-fought victory in overtime. The match's intensity peaked during the final map on Border, where both teams displayed exceptional skill and strategy. With the score tied and the pressure mounting, Shopify Rebellion found themselves in a precarious 2v4 situation. It was here that the composure and talent of players like Jaylen "Ambi" Turk and Troy "Canadian" Jaroslawski shone through as they executed a stunning comeback, securing the victory for their team.
Key Players and Standout Performances
While the match's outcome was a testament to the collective strength of Shopify Rebellion, individual performances also played a critical role. William "Spoit" Löfstedt, a former member of M80, delivered an outstanding performance, finishing the match with a SiegeGG rating of 1.26 and amassing an impressive 40 kills. His contribution was particularly notable on Border, where he secured 20 kills alone, demonstrating his exceptional skill in high-pressure situations.
Spoit’s performance underscores the fierce competition within the league, as former team dynamics and rivalries add layers of intrigue to the matches. His ability to dominate the entry kill department, achieving nine entry kills, highlights his tactical acumen and ability to secure crucial advantages for his team.
